Nice amenities for a hotel in a great location. It’s just walking distance from many shops and restaurants. It’s just a few blocks from the Praça do Comércio so you have access to most lines of transportation nearby. We were able to walk to Castro De Sao Jorge but make sure you’re ready for the hike uphill. This place is right in the mix of it all so be prepared for all the commercial activity and busy hours of the day but I think it’s a great centralized place to stay in if you’re a first timer to Lisbon.

My wife and I were originally due to stay here at New Year but that trip got cancelled, One thing about the locations is its right in the middle of everything and would be a superb location at New Year as two main squares are at either end of the road.

We had noticed some comments about the size of the bedrooms but found them to be absolutely fine. Yes, not huge but enough storage space for our things and plenty of room to move around. Fridge and coffee facilities were good features.

Our room was on the first floor, facing the street and external noise was minimal thanks to the excellent glazing.

Staff were very polite during our stay. First night the reception staff helped fix a wifi issue on our tablets for us.

Breakfast was mixed and this is where the "little niggles" come in. The hotel is small, and therefore the dining area small. Normally this isn't a problem but if you get a sudden rush, space can be a problem. The food was varied. Both my wife and I found plenty of choice but there was 1 issue, again due to the size of the hotel. If you arrived when the hot food had been put out, you will have no problems..BUT the small number of guests meant it didnt need to be replenished very quickly and one morning it was cold when we arrived, but when replenished was absolutely fine. Both toaster and pancake maker were in full working order.

Within the reception area of the hotel is a small seating area, with a TV showing news channels. There is also a coffee machine for which you pay a small amount (standard coffee in the rooms were free and replenished every day).

We noted during our stay that building works is being carried out in the building next doors, and the hotel will be expanding. We had no issues with the works during our stay, and thinks the expansion may help with the breakfast room issues above (more space, and more guest for turnaround).

Room tip: Don't be put off by rooms facing the road. Glazing is excellent.

We have just returned from Lisbon. The hotel was a fab location minutes close to everywhere we wanted to visit. Cannot fault the position at all. Check in was nice and easy. We were in room 403 which was a large room, very clean and light. Large double bed and a GREAT Shower! We also had a Juliet Balcony, a table and chairs. A full kitchen which i was not expecting. A couple of teas and coffees were on offer - powdered milk you had to buy for 20Cent. Free safe, iron and hairdryer also in the room.
The room was quite hot so we opened a window, that was a mistake as the building next door is having some building work and we were woken up everyday at 5am. If you closed the window the noise was not as bad but still could hear the work being done. I do think the booking agent (hotel.com) should of notified us to advise of this work.
Other than that the hotel was Great and I would recommend and I would personally stay here again.
